Land Rover has never been a company that shies away from obstacles, so it lit out across the pond back in March 1987 to conquer America and hasn't looked back. Americans already had their beloved Jeep, so Land Rover got off to a somewhat slow start, taking about a decade and a half to sell the first 100,000 vehicles in the United States. Word got around about it as quickly and effortlessly as it gets around tree stumps, however, and it only took another five more months to move the next 150,000. Of course, the legendary Defender was yanked from our shores when it didn't pass the air bag test (OK, it had none), but the brand grew with the Discovery/LR4, the Freelander/LR2 and the Range Rover just kept getting better and now it has reached the half-million sales mark here in the States.
